Russian-Chinese lunar station project underway

Supported by 13 countries

Dmitry Bakanov, Director General of the state corporation “Roscosmos“, said that the initiative of Russia and China to create an International Scientific Lunar Station is being actively implemented and that to date 13 countries have joined the project. This was said during a meeting of the heads of the space agencies of the BRICS countries.

During his speech, Bakanov said that in addition to Russia and China, cooperation within the framework of this project is also being carried out with Azerbaijan, Belarus, Bolivia, Venezuela, Djibouti, Egypt, Nicaragua, Pakistan, Senegal, Serbia, Thailand, Ethiopia and the Republic of South Africa.

We will recall that last year Vladimir Putin signed a law ratifying an agreement with the Chinese government on cooperation in creating a lunar station. The agreement itself on the creation and operation of a station for the study and use of the Moon was concluded between Moscow and Beijing in November 2022.

According to Roscosmos, Russia, together with China, plans to deploy a nuclear power plant on the lunar station, the development of which is already underway. After the development is completed, the installation will be tested on Earth, and its sending to the Moon is planned for 2036. In addition, the plans for the station include the construction of a nuclear power plant on the surface of the satellite of our planet.
